A compromised interaction cannot be repaired by server-side evidence after the event. The application must be able to assess its own integrity, inspect the environment in which it is running and impose a proportionate response before hostile control becomes an authorised action.
DexProtector and Alice can embed malware and Potentially Harmful App detection inside the final application, including signature, heuristic and package-based checks, with intelligence specifically designed to detect malware that abuses Android Accessibility Services. Combined with UI protection, RASP and device attestation, the app can identify overlays, screen capture, keylogging, remote-access tooling and other forms of client-side interference.
Under an agreed rapid-response operating model, a verified indicator can be added to the over-the-air threat database and mapped to a pre-approved enforcement policy without waiting for an app-store release. Protected instances can then detect the new strain and report, warn, restrict, suspend or stop the interaction. For high-volume digital services, compressing that exposure window can materially reduce the period during which transaction flows worth billions of dirhams remain at risk.
Target timing depends on indicator quality, technical validation, configuration, connectivity and the agreed service scope; it is not presented as a universal product SLA.
